
Sunken Slab Repair in Odessa
Sunken slab repair is a crucial service for homeowners in Odessa, FL, where shifting soil and settling foundations can lead to uneven and cracked concrete surfaces. Common problems include trip hazards, water pooling, and structural damage that can worsen over time. The need for prompt and effective repair solutions is essential to restore the integrity and appearance of driveways, patios, and other concrete areas. Solutions often involve techniques such as slab jacking or polyurethane foam injection to lift and stabilize the sunken concrete. Addressing these issues promptly helps maintain property value and ensures safety for residents.
